Output 1375e34160ed6c376514292c875ecaff6b523599262df71f3373eecbacffe561:0
- value
- 50000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7c5ad31de9db82ccc4a239eed7c69ab2654a5fe OP_EQUAL
- address
- 3MMv1bRFizjhirfZSU5FXaQdAvnipbdP9n
- transaction
- 1375e34160ed6c376514292c875ecaff6b523599262df71f3373eecbacffe561
- confirmations
- 294913
- spent
- true